INTELLIGENCE DOSSIER: MOHAMMAD BIN SALMAN AL SAUD

Mohammad bin Salman is the Crown Prince of Saudi Arabia and de facto leader of the Kingdom, serving as both Prime Minister since 2022 and Minister of Defense. His strategic significance derives from Saudi Arabia's dual role as the world's largest oil exporter and a major geopolitical actor across the Middle East, positioning him as a critical node in energy markets, regional security architecture, and U.S. foreign policy calculations under the Trump administration.
